2007 Florida Building Code in effect March 1, 2009

By plansource

As of March 1, 2009, the 2007 Florida Building Code will be in effect statewide.  The electrical code will not be changing at that time, but is expected to be updated in the coming months.

The new code has a myriad of minor changes and clarifications that affect most aspects of residential construction.  The most sweeping changes are to the Energy Code, which now requires a much higher degree of energy efficiency in all new homes.  This includes air conditioning/heating units, windows, doors, insulation, and other aspects to conserve energy.

However, it is important that consumers be aware that this extra cost will have to be passed from the homebuilders to the buyers.  These new products and regulations add costs to the home that hopefully will repay itself over time.
